The National Association of Chronic Disease Directors (NACDD) runs "Nobody Alone Can Defeat Disease," to inform the public about how to prevent chronic diseases and improve health.

Join us Thursday, Sept. 8 from 3-4 p.m. ET for our General Member Webinar - Reducing the Risk of Cognitive Decline and Dementia: What You Need to Know

In our Sept. 8 General Member Webinar, Matthew Baumgart, the Principal Investigator for CDC's Public Health Center of Excellence on Dementia Risk Reduction, will review the current state of the science on modifiable risk factors for cognitive decline and dementia as well as social determinants of health related to dementia risk.
